If the car is moving at all, it will grind going into first no matter what.

If I am stopped in neutral (clutch out), I go to put the clutch in and put it in first, it will grind. BUT if I put it in second gear before I go into first, it will go in no problem. If I were to do the second-to-neutral-to-first scenario, it will go in fine. When I bled the clutch I had someone put the trans in gear and step on the clutch and I was able to spin the driveshaft by hand. That, and the fact that it goes into all other gears at a stop like butter leads me to believe that it is not clutch related.

I had the same problem with the T56 in my GTO - it was a synchro problem with it. The transmission ate synchros - as I've never, ever had a synchro die in any of my other manual transmission cars; odds are, there was a problem with the manufacture of the transmission.... some had a mis-alignment of the (IIRC) main shaft that GM replaced under warranty.
